Abstract

A kind of low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, be composited by corona layer, sandwich layer and hot sealing layer, described sandwich layer is between corona layer, hot sealing layer; Described corona layer is made up of polypropylene block copolymer resins, and described sandwich layer is made up of polypropylene block copolymer resins 70-90%, thermoplastic elastomer (TPE) 10-30% and mustard acyl acid amide slipping agent 0.2%; Described hot sealing layer material is made up of polypropylene block copol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ent 0.15% and mustard acyl acid amide slipping agent 0.15%.Patent of the present invention has that resistance to low temperature is excellent, impact strength is large, puncture resistance is good, and also have the advantage of resistance to boiling, the mode by pasteurization or poach carries out sterilization treatment simultaneously.This film, mainly for the packaging of goods needing refrigeration, has the characteristics such as cold-resistant freezing, puncture resistant, shock resistance.Therefore the plastic flexible package needing deepfreeze and sterilization treatment can be widely used in.

The low temperature resistant anti-impact type cast polypropylene film of resistance to boiling
Technical field
The present invention relates to a kind of polypropylene film of resistance to boiling, especially a kind of low temperature resistant anti-impact type cast polypropylene film of resistance to boiling.
Background technology
In plastic flexible package application, because some packing articles will carry out deepfreeze, some is packaged in application process and can runs into different ambient temperature conditions in addition, especially winter temperature difference can be very large, temperature as the north is reduced to about-30 DEG C sometimes, in this case, some packing articles shock resistance will be deteriorated because of black brittleness.Now just there will be various problem: 1, the impact resistance of sack is poor, transport, handling, shelf put the destruction being easily subject to external power in process, very easily there is broken bag, open a bag phenomenon, not only affect the outward appearance of packaging product, the due effect of packaging itself can not be played simultaneously.2, the cold resistance of frozen food does not reach requirement, and when temperature is lower, can not keep the original performance of material, packaging material are more crisp, packaging material mechanical strength is declined, causes packaging bag to break and ftracture, and more can not meet the protective effect to content.3, the puncture resistance of packaging bag, frozen food freezing rear be generally harder, particularly fish, meat products, containing bone and hard objects, transport and stack in product extruding be easy to packaging bag is worn out, packaging bag sealing is damaged, and therefore frozen food requires very high to the puncture of packaging bag.
The now commercially common following structure of the many employings of Frozen Food Packaging composite membrane: the properties of product of this structure of OPP/LLDPE can reach moistureproof, cold-resistant, low-temperature heat-sealing pulling force is strong, and cost is relatively economic; The packaging character of this structure of NY/LLDPE can resistance to freezing, shock-resistant, puncture, and cost is relatively high, packing of product better performances; And PET/LLDPE structure also has use in freezing series products, but utilization rate is relatively low; Also having a kind of is in addition simple PE bag, such as vegetables packaging etc.; Above several prods structure is that the cryogenic freezing packing of product of present domestic market uses the structure relatively concentrated.
In above-mentioned packaging, employing be LLDPE as hot sealing layer material, but due to the transparency of LLDPE poor, and because fusing point and the lower boiling resistance of Vicat softening point can be also poor.Therefore pack for the goods that visualization requirements is high and need the packaging for foodstuff of water boiling resistance or resistance to boiling sterilization, adopting LLDPE film will there is certain limitation.
Summary of the invention
The object of the invention is to provide a kind of low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, adopts LLDPE as hot sealing layer material to solve existing Frozen Food Packaging composite membrane, fusing point and Vicat softening point lower, boiling resistance can the technical problem such as poor.
The present invention is mainly solved the problems of the technologies described above by following technical proposals: a kind of low temperature resistant anti-impact type cast polypropylene film, is composited by corona layer, sandwich layer and hot sealing layer, it is characterized in that described sandwich layer is between corona layer, hot sealing layer; Described corona layer is made up of polypropylene block copolymer resins, and described sandwich layer is made up of polypropylene block copolymer resins 70%, thermoplastic elastomer (TPE) 29.8% and erucamide slip agent 0.2%; Described hot sealing layer material is polypropylene block copol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ent 0.15% and erucamide slip agent 0.15% forms.
As preferably, described corona layer, sandwich layer and hot sealing layer three layer by layer thickness rate are 1:3:1.
As preferably, described thermoplastic elastomer (TPE) is polyethylen-octene elastomer, ethene and the 2-butene elastomer mixture that forms of 2:1 in mass ratio altogether.
As preferably, described polypropylene block copolymer can be one or more combinations of HOPP resin, acrylic resin copolymer, copolymerization and HOPP resin.
As preferably, described synthetic wollastonite antitack agent is made up of the polypropylene of 90%, the blended granulation of wollastonite of 10%.
As preferably, described erucamide slip agent is made up of the polypropylene of 95%, the blended granulation of erucyl amide of 5%.
As preferably, described corona layer surface, after high-frequency discharge process, obtains the sided corona treatment value that moistened surface tension force is greater than 38 dyne.
In the present invention, the polyethylen-octene elastomer that elastomer and the mixing of ethene-2 butene elastomer obtain altogether is contributed larger to the low-temperature impact performance of material, this is because play connection, cushioning effect between each composition of elastomer, make system play dispersion when being subject to impacting, shock absorbing can, reduce crazing because of the stressed chance developing into crackle, thus improve the impact strength of system.When system is subject to tension force, can there is larger deformation in the network-like structure formed due to these tie-points, so the elongation at break of system has significant increase, shock resistance strengthens.
Anti-blocking agent can form many projections or different the concavo-convex of shape that relax on the surface of finished films, the surface of finished films is made to reach certain roughness, like this finished films stack or roll up put together time, can allow between each thin layer and retain a certain amount of air, thus effective contact area between minimizing film, reach the effect preventing film blocking.
Slipping agent is dispersed in plastic sheeting by melt extruding, and finally can migrate to film surface fast in production with in using, form a smooth layer, reduce the coefficient of friction of film surface, make it not adhesion mutually, order unreels and cuts more smooth and easy, and has good Kekelé structure count.

Detailed description of the invention
Below by embodiment, technical scheme of the present invention is described in further detail.Fig. 1 is structural representation of the present invention, as shown in the figure, this low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, is composited by corona layer 1, sandwich layer 2 and hot sealing layer 3, its sandwich layer 2 is between corona layer 1, hot sealing layer 3, and corona layer, sandwich layer and hot sealing layer three layer by layer thickness rate is 1:3:1.
embodiment 1:this low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, its corona layer is made up of polyproplyene block copolymer resins; Sandwich layer gathers resin 70% by polyproplyene block copolymerization, thermoplastic elastomer (TPE) (polyethylen-octene is elastomer, ethene and the 2-butene elastomer mixture that forms of 2:1 in mass ratio altogether) 29.8% and erucamide slip agent (polypropylene of 95%, the blended granulation of high-purity erucyl amide of 5% are made, lower together) 0.2% forms; Hot sealing layer is made up of polypropylene block copol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ent (polypropylene of 90%, the blended granulation of the wollastonite of 10% are made, lower same) 0.15%, erucamide slip agent 0.15%.Above-mentioned trilaminate material carries out melting respectively through three single screw extrusion machines, then carries out film forming through the cooling of block of ingredient connector, T-shaped die head co-extrusion and curtain coating.Product follow-up through cooling and shaping, Thickness sensitivity, sided corona treatment, rolling, Ageing Treatment, cut and pack, obtain final products.In above embodiment, corona layer surface, after high-frequency discharge process, obtains the sided corona treatment value that moistened surface tension force is greater than 38 dyne.
embodiment 2:this low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, its corona layer is made up of boiling level propylene binary random vinyl chloride; Sandwich layer is made up of polypropylene homo resin 79.8%, thermoplastic elastomer (TPE) (polyethylen-octene is elastomer, ethene and the 2-butene elastomer mixture that forms of 2:1 in mass ratio altogether) 20% and erucamide slip agent 0.2%; Hot sealing layer is made up of polypropylene binary random copol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ent 0.15%, erucamide slip agent 0.15%.Above-mentioned trilaminate material carries out melting respectively through three single screw extrusion machines, then carries out film forming through the cooling of block of ingredient connector, T-shaped die head co-extrusion and curtain coating.Product follow-up through cooling and shaping, Thickness sensitivity, sided corona treatment, rolling, Ageing Treatment, cut and pack, obtain final products.In above embodiment, corona layer surface, after high-frequency discharge process, obtains the sided corona treatment value that moistened surface tension force is greater than 38 dyne.
embodiment 3:this low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, its corona layer is made up of boiling level propylene binary random vinyl chloride; Sandwich layer is made up of polypropylene homo resin 89.8%, thermoplastic elastomer (TPE) (polyethylen-octene is elastomer, ethene and the 2-butene elastomer mixture that forms of 2:1 in mass ratio altogether) 10% and erucamide slip agent 0.2%; Hot sealing layer is made up of polypropylene terpol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ent 0.15%, erucamide slip agent 0.15%.Above-mentioned trilaminate material carries out melting respectively through three single screw extrusion machines, then carries out film forming through the cooling of block of ingredient connector, T-shaped die head co-extrusion and curtain coating.Product follow-up through cooling and shaping, Thickness sensitivity, sided corona treatment, rolling, Ageing Treatment, cut and pack, obtain final products.In above embodiment, corona layer surface, after high-frequency discharge process, obtains the sided corona treatment value that moistened surface tension force is greater than 38 dyne.
embodiment 4:this low temperature resistant anti-impact type cast polypropylene film of resistance to boiling, its corona layer is made up of boiling level propylene binary random vinyl chloride; Sandwich layer is made up of polypropylene binary copolymerization resin 80%, thermoplastic elastomer (TPE) (polyethylen-octene is elastomer, ethene and the 2-butene elastomer mixture that forms of 2:1 in mass ratio altogether) 19.8% and erucamide slip agent 0.2%; Hot sealing layer is made up of polypropylene terpolymer 89.7%, ethylene-alpha-olefin copolymer 10%, synthetic wollastonite antitack agent 0.15%, erucamide slip agent (polypropylene of 95%, the blended granulation of high-purity erucyl amide of 5% are made) 0.15%.Above-mentioned trilaminate material carries out melting respectively through three single screw extrusion machines, then carries out film forming through the cooling of block of ingredient connector, T-shaped die head co-extrusion and curtain coating.Product follow-up through cooling and shaping, Thickness sensitivity, sided corona treatment, rolling, Ageing Treatment, cut and pack, obtain final products.In above embodiment, corona layer surface, after high-frequency discharge process, obtains the sided corona treatment value that moistened surface tension force is greater than 38 dyne.

The item following points that production process of the present invention pays particular attention to: one, the dust impurities of raw material controls: raw material is from spice to conveying, require to carry out under air-proof condition, isolate with the curtain coating workshop of extruding of film between storage workshop and spice skip car, avoid the dust of raw material to enter casting unit; Two, crystalline substance point and the charing point control of process is melt extruded: every platform extruder and die head connector have filter, filter is to adopt the mode of cascade filtration for the best, filter divides coarse filtration and essence to filter two sections, thus avoids brilliant some charing point to wait impurity to enter die head to greatest extent; Three, deflector roll requires: casting unit to the deflector roll that rolling unit is all needs through special surface treatment; Four, workshop environmental requirement: production process requires to carry out in dust-free workshop inside, workshop degree of purification requires more than 1000 grades, wherein require from curtain coating cooling unit to rolling unit to adopt poly (methyl methacrylate) plate to isolate, production operation personnel need to dress special garment for clean room, headgear and mouth mask as far as possible; Five, film dividing mode: the mode of cutting is taked to cut online, unreels the infringement of process to film when avoiding film secondary to cut.Six, the process of heating crystalline again of film: needed a heating and cooling device to heat again film before rolling, heating-up temperature 50 DEG C-100 DEG C, its objective is to accelerate film recrystallization, reduce the film curing time, thus polymer molecular chain is fully extended sizing, avoid rolling rear film to shrink distortion.

Result of the test shows: the present invention's low temperature resistant anti-impact type cast polypropylene film of resistance to boiling mainly contains following feature: 1. elastic modelling quantity is large, and deflection is high, and its elastic modelling quantity and hot strength are all greater than general thin; 2. initial heat-sealing temperature is low; 3. glossiness is fine, and mist degree is excellent, and the properties of transparency of product is better; 4. low temperature impact strength is high, and the scope of application is wide.
